If you’re self-employed or thinking about running your own business there are a number of options you have available to you in order to help you find the dental coverage for you or your family. You can find this information both online and in local area.Items that you should be particularly focused on include:Professional organizations or groups: If you’re a member of a specific social organization or group, either for your profession or for personal interests, you may be able to benefit from some specific discounts or plans that they may have available. Check in with your local group representative to see if they have any of these options available to you.Family plans: Many companies and organizations offer various plans for your family that could include coverage for you for children or your spouse. If one of your family members is already covered by one of these plans you may have access to coverage already. Check with them or their insurance company to see if you qualify for their coverage as well. You may be surprised.Provider access organization membership: Provider access organizations operate nationwide and provide large discounts at a number of dental and medical providers that may be a viable option for you. Looking into one of these could potentially cut down monthly premium costs for insurance medical plans substantially, allowing you in turn to invest more funds into your personal business growth. The drawbacks of these plans are that they may not allow you to go to the provider of your choice as they may restrict you to certain providers in the area that they have negotiated discounts with. Ask around fully and weigh up the pros and cons before committing to an agreementRegardless of your interests, check online or local media for the most up-to-date information available to you regarding ease to for options.
